Our educators embrace student-centered strategies such as STEAM, Project-Based Learning, and the design thinking model, which encourages students to ask, imagine, plan, create, and improve. These approaches help students think critically and creatively. We also partner with local businesses whose professionals help guide students through real-world applications—building essential teamwork and 21st-century skills.
At Hughes, we focus on developing the whole child. Through our partnership with Mentor Upstate, we offer a mentoring program that supports our at-risk population. We’ve also launched a peer tutoring program, single-gender leadership clubs, and a formalized intervention protocol to ensure that every student receives the support they need. Leadership development is a priority, and we believe these opportunities prepare students not only for school, but for life.
We promote a positive culture through our school-wide behavior framework called ROCK along with Live school, which emphasizes Respect, Order, Communication, and Kindness. We also meet basic needs through our HAK PAK program, which provides weekend meals to food-insecure students and families.
Beyond the classroom, our students engage in a wide range of activities including Robotics, Lego Club, Spanish Club, Math Counts, Beta Club, Theater Club, and numerous athletic programs which create space for every child to explore their interests and talents.
We believe that school, family, and community must work together as one team to deliver a high-quality education. We’re proud to be recognized as a National PTSA School of Excellence. Our School Improvement Council and PTSA are vital partners in decisions about student activities, community needs, and program development.
